What is subsurface mapping?

i. A map depicting geologic data or features below the Earth’s surface; esp. a plan of mine workings, or a structure-contour map of a petroleum reservoir or an underground ore deposit, coal seam, or key bed.

What are seismic methods of subsurface investigations?

Seismic techniques are commonly used to determine site geology, stratigraphy, and rock quality. These techniques provide detailed information about subsurface layering and rock geomechanical properties using seismic acoustical waves. Reflection and Refraction are the most commonly used seismic techniques.

What does an isopach map show?

Isopach maps display the stratigraphic thickness between an upper and lower horizon. It is measured as the shortest distance between the two surfaces. Isopach maps provide a more accurate picture of stratigraphic thickness, because it reflects the thickness of the deposited bed.

An isochron map is a contour map of equal values of seismic traveltime between selected events. Isochron maps are the seismic analog of isochore maps and, as such, are intended to derive thickness information from seismic data.

What is subsurface in oil and gas?

subsurface in the Oil and Gas Industry Subsurface means in a well, or below the surface of the ground. Seismic surveys are used to find subsurface rock structures that may contain hydrocarbons.

Which method use subsurface exploration?

The use of an inadequate exploratory method caused many-a-time the loss of money and time on unproductive investigation of the building site. The subsurface in- vestigation for engineering constructions is made with the use of (1) test pits and trenches, (2) exploratory drifts, (3) sounding and (4) boreholes.

Which method uses geophones for subsurface exploration?

Seismic or acoustic methods measure the travel times of the reflected or refracted waves detected by a series of geophones placed on the ground surface and are able to estimate the location and depth of the targets.

What has subsurface scattering?

Subsurface scattering is important for realistic 3D computer graphics, being necessary for the rendering of materials such as marble, skin, leaves, wax and milk. If subsurface scattering is not implemented, the material may look unnatural, like plastic or metal.
